Key Responsibilities
  • Perform server rack installations, hardware break‑fix, and physical repair of various components.
  • Diagnose and troubleshoot network issues and respond to operational incidents that impact service availability.
  • Carry out routine network, server hardware, and operating system repairs to improve overall service availability.
  • Serve as the primary contact point for internal and external stakeholders, including engineers, software developers, vendors, and contractors.
  • Participate in on‑call duties and scheduled maintenance and change‑management activities.
  • Contribute to documentation and process‑improvement initiatives based on the analysis of operational issues.
  • Help interview, train, and onboard new team members.
Physical Requirements
  • Lift and move material up to 40 pounds.
  • Work in cramped and/or elevated locations.
  • Bend, lift, stretch, and reach as needed.
  • Stand and walk for up to eight or more hours a day.
  • Ascend and descend ladders, stairs, and gangways safely without limitation.
  • Work in an industrial environment.
  • Work shifts longer than eight hours to support 24/7 operations, including nights, weekends, and holidays.
  • Travel may be required to data center locations in various operational stages.

Day in the Life

Our Data Center Technicians own the technical resolution of customer‑facing issues, engage cross‑functional teams, solve problems at the root, maintain service level agreements, and innovate processes. They work shifts that include days, nights, weekends, and holidays.

Basic Qualifications
  • 2+ years of computer/server hardware troubleshooting experience, or related IT experience.
  • 2+ years of computer layer 1/2 networking experience, including troubleshooting and repair.
  • Work a flexible schedule, including weekends, nights, and holidays.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Knowledge of network design, protocols, and troubleshooting.
  • Knowledge of Linux/Unix administration.
  • Bachelor’s degree in an IT‑related field (e.g., Computer Science, Network Engineering) or equivalent professional or military IT experience.
  • Experience in a data center or other critical environment.
  • Experience training and onboarding new team members.
